Fragment from a lid rim, opaque whiteware with polychrome of bi-chrome lustre; Iraq (Baghdad or Basra), 9th century.

Fragment from a flat topped lid, earthenware of yellow calcareous clay body, with tin-opacified lead glaze, the top decorated with a trellis-like ground in gold lustre overlaid with ovoid leaf-like motifs in gold and brown. The rim edge is painted with thick and thin bands beneath a painted escalopped band. Evidence of ruby lustre smudges. Interior undecorated.
